Overview Pza Ciba 500mg Tablet
Ciba Pza 500mg tablets are anti-tuberculosis antibiotics. These medications combat tuberculosis, a lung infection sometimes affecting other organs. Always use Ciba Pza 500mg in conjunction with at least one other anti-tuberculosis drug, as directed by your physician. Its mechanism involves eradicating the disease-causing bacteria. Adhere strictly to your prescribed dosage and treatment duration. Take this medication at the same time each day, with or without food, to maintain consistent levels. Complete the entire course, even with symptom improvement; premature discontinuation risks treatment failure and increased side effects. Weight changes should be reported to your doctor, as dosage adjustments may be necessary based on body weight. If a dose is missed, take it immediately; however, if the next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your regular schedule. Never double the dose. Report jaundice (yellowing skin or eyes), dark urine, abdominal pain, or joint pain to your doctor. Hepatitis, elevated liver enzymes, and arthralgia are potential side effects requiring medical attention and possible dosage alteration. Your doctor may monitor liver function during treatment.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to potential liver damage. Pregnant or lactating individuals must consult their doctor before using this medication.

How Pza Ciba 500mg Tablet works:
Ciba 500mg tablets contain Pza, an anti-TB agent. Metabolically transformed into pyrazinoic acid, it acts by suppressing bacterial fatty acid synthase I, a crucial enzyme for mycobacterial proliferation. This bactericidal effect halts bacterial growth, thereby treating tuberculosis.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Concurrent alcohol use with Pza Ciba 500mg tablets requires careful consideration.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Pza Ciba 500m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to a f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Based on current evidence, it's likely safe to take a 500mg Pza Ciba tablet while breastfeeding. Available human data indicates minimal risk to the infant.
Dr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The effect of Pza Ciba 500mg Tablet on driving ability is unknown. Refrain from driving if experiencing sym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with severe kidney impairment should exercise caution when using 500mg Pza Ciba t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. A physician's consultation is recommended. Assessment of kidney function is advisable prior to commencing treatment.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Pza Ciba 500m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Physician consultation is recommended. Liver function should be regularly assessed both prior to and following treatment initiation.
